declare(strict_types=1);
namespace pocketmine\block;
use pocketmine\block\tile\Sign as TileSign;
use pocketmine\block\utils\BlockDataSerializer;
use pocketmine\block\utils\SignText;
use pocketmine\event\block\SignChangeEvent;
use pocketmine\item\Item;
use pocketmine\math\AxisAlignedBB;
use pocketmine\math\Facing;
use pocketmine\math\Vector3;
use pocketmine\player\Player;
use pocketmine\utils\TextFormat;
use pocketmine\world\BlockTransaction;
use function array_map;
use function assert;
use function floor;
use function strlen;
class Sign extends Transparent{
/** @var BlockIdentifierFlattened */
protected $idInfo;
//TODO: conditionally useless properties, find a way to fix
/** @var int */
protected $rotation = 0;
/** @var int */
protected $facing = Facing::UP;
/** @var SignText */
protected $text;
public function __construct(BlockIdentifierFlattened $idInfo, string $name, ?BlockBreakInfo $breakInfo = null){
parent::__construct($idInfo, $name, $breakInfo ?? new BlockBreakInfo(1.0, BlockToolType::AXE));
$this->text = new SignText();
}
public function __clone(){
parent::__clone();
$this->text = clone $this->text;
}
public function getId() : int{
return $this->facing === Facing::UP ? parent::getId() : $this->idInfo->getSecondId();
}
protected function writeStateToMeta() : int{
if($this->facing === Facing::UP){
return $this->rotation;
}
return BlockDataSerializer::writeHorizontalFacing($this->facing);
}
public function readStateFromData(int $id, int $stateMeta) : void{
if($id === $this->idInfo->getSecondId()){
$this->facing = BlockDataSerializer::readHorizontalFacing($stateMeta);
}else{
$this->facing = Facing::UP;
$this->rotation = $stateMeta;
}
}
public function readStateFromWorld() : void{
parent::readStateFromWorld();
$tile = $this->pos->getWorld()->getTile($this->pos);
if($tile instanceof TileSign){
$this->text = $tile->getText();
}
}
public function writeStateToWorld() : void{
parent::writeStateToWorld();
$tile = $this->pos->getWorld()->getTile($this->pos);
assert($tile instanceof TileSign);
$tile->setText($this->text);
}
public function getStateBitmask() : int{
return 0b1111;
}
public function isSolid() : bool{
return false;
}
/**
* @return AxisAlignedBB[]
*/
protected function recalculateCollisionBoxes() : array{
return [];
}
public function place(BlockTransaction $tx, Item $item, Block $blockReplace, Block $blockClicked, int $face, Vector3 $clickVector, ?Player $player = null) : bool{
if($face !== Facing::DOWN){
$this->facing = $face;
if($face === Facing::UP){
$this->rotation = $player !== null ? ((int) floor((($player->getLocation()->getYaw() + 180) * 16 / 360) + 0.5)) & 0x0f : 0;
}
return parent::place($tx, $item, $blockReplace, $blockClicked, $face, $clickVector, $player);
}
return false;
}
public function onNearbyBlockChange() : void{
if($this->getSide(Facing::opposite($this->facing))->getId() === BlockLegacyIds::AIR){
$this->pos->getWorld()->useBreakOn($this->pos);
}
}
/**
* Returns an object containing information about the sign text.
*/
public function getText() : SignText{
return $this->text;
}
/**
* Called by the player controller (network session) to update the sign text, firing events as appropriate.
*
* @return bool if the sign update was successful.
* @throws \UnexpectedValueException if the text payload is too large
*/
public function updateText(Player $author, SignText $text) : bool{
$size = 0;
foreach($text->getLines() as $line){
$size += strlen($line);
}
if($size > 1000){
throw new \UnexpectedValueException($author->getName() . " tried to write $size bytes of text onto a sign (bigger than max 1000)");
}
$removeFormat = $author->getRemoveFormat();
$ev = new SignChangeEvent($this, $author, new SignText(array_map(function(string $line) use ($removeFormat) : string{
return TextFormat::clean($line, $removeFormat);
}, $text->getLines())));
$ev->call();
if(!$ev->isCancelled()){
$this->text = clone $ev->getNewText();
$this->pos->getWorld()->setBlock($this->pos, $this);
return true;
}
return false;
}
}
